2839 Dixwell Ave, Hamden, CT 06518, USA
1676 Dixwell Ave, Hamden, CT 06514, USA
1188 Dixwell Ave, Hamden, CT 06514, USA
1188 Dixwell Ave, Hamden, CT 06514, USA
1700 Dixwell Ave, Hamden, CT 06514, USA
2647 Dixwell Ave, Hamden, CT 06518, USA
2839 Dixwell Ave, Hamden, CT 06518, USA
1188 Dixwell Ave, Hamden, CT 06514, USA
2911 Dixwell Ave, Hamden, CT 06518, USA